HOW CAN WE MEASURE STRESS? a. Psychological Questionnaires The field of psychology concentrates on the measurement of abstract concepts, such as language, cognition, personality and emotions, to name a few. WebAnother popular way to measure stress is through hormone testing. This approach looks at biomarkers such as cortisol and adrenaline that are released when the body experiences stressful situations.
